21 years agoAdjust parser so that 'x NOT IN (subselect)' is converted to
Tom Lane [Thu, 9 Jan 2003 20:50:53 +0000 (20:50 +0000)]
Adjust parser so that 'x NOT IN (subselect)' is converted to
'NOT (x IN (subselect))', that is 'NOT (x = ANY (subselect))',
rather than 'x <> ALL (subselect)' as we formerly did.  This
opens the door to optimizing NOT IN the same way as IN, whereas
there's no hope of optimizing the expression using <>.  Also,
convert 'x <> ALL (subselect)' to the NOT(IN) style, so that
the optimization will be available when processing rules dumped
by older Postgres versions.
initdb forced due to small change in SubLink node representation.

21 years agoThe second was that renegotiation was just plain broken. I can't
Bruce Momjian [Wed, 8 Jan 2003 23:18:25 +0000 (23:18 +0000)]
The second was that renegotiation was just plain broken.  I can't
believe I didn't notice this before -- once 64k was sent to/from the
server the client would crash.  Basicly, in 7.3 the server SSL code set
the initial state to "about to renegotiate" without actually starting
the renegotiation.  In addition, the server and client didn't properly
handle the SSL_ERROR_WANT_(READ|WRITE) error.  This is fixed in the
second patch.

Nathan Mueller

21 years agoTweak mdnblocks() to avoid doing lseek() on segments that it has
Tom Lane [Tue, 7 Jan 2003 01:19:12 +0000 (01:19 +0000)]
Tweak mdnblocks() to avoid doing lseek() on segments that it has
previously determined not to be the last segment of a relation.
This reduces the expected cost to one seek, rather than one seek per
segment.  We can get away with this because truncation of a relation
will cause a relcache flush and so the md.c file descriptor will be
closed; when it is re-opened we will re-determine the last segment.

21 years agoFrom the SSL_CTX_new man page:
PostgreSQL Daemon [Wed, 18 Dec 2002 13:15:15 +0000 (13:15 +0000)]
From the SSL_CTX_new man page:

"SSLv23_method(void), SSLv23_server_method(void), SSLv23_client_method(void)

 A TLS/SSL connection established with these methods will understand the SSLv2,
 SSLv3, and TLSv1 protocol. A client will send out SSLv2 client hello messages
 and will indicate that it also understands SSLv3 and TLSv1. A server will
 understand SSLv2, SSLv3, and TLSv1 client hello messages. This is the best
 choice when compatibility is a concern."

This will maintain backwards compatibility for those us that don't use
TLS connections ...
